QItemModelBarDataProxy#

Inheritance diagram of PySide6.QtGraphs.QItemModelBarDataProxy

Synopsis#

Properties#

Functions#

Signals#

Note

This documentation may contain snippets that were automatically translated from C++ to Python. We always welcome contributions to the snippet translation. If you see an issue with the translation, you can also let us know by creating a ticket on https:/bugreports.qt.io/projects/PYSIDE

Detailed Description#

class PySide6.QtGraphs.QItemModelBarDataProxy(itemModel[, parent=None])#

PySide6.QtGraphs.QItemModelBarDataProxy(itemModel, rowRole, columnRole, valueRole[, parent=None])

PySide6.QtGraphs.QItemModelBarDataProxy(itemModel, rowRole, columnRole, valueRole, rotationRole[, parent=None])

PySide6.QtGraphs.QItemModelBarDataProxy(itemModel, rowRole, columnRole, valueRole, rotationRole, rowCategories, columnCategories[, parent=None])

PySide6.QtGraphs.QItemModelBarDataProxy(itemModel, rowRole, columnRole, valueRole, rowCategories, columnCategories[, parent=None])

PySide6.QtGraphs.QItemModelBarDataProxy(itemModel, valueRole[, parent=None])

PySide6.QtGraphs.QItemModelBarDataProxy([parent=None])

Parameters:

Note

Properties can be used directly when from __feature__ import true_property is used or via accessor functions otherwise.

property PᅟySide6.QtGraphs.QItemModelBarDataProxy.autoColumnCategories: bool#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.autoRowCategories: bool#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.columnCategories: list of strings#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.columnRole: str#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.columnRolePattern: PySide6.QtCore.QRegularExpression#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.columnRoleReplace: str#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.itemModel: PySide6.QtCore.QAbstractItemModel#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.multiMatchBehavior: MultiMatchBehavior#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.rotationRole: str#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.rotationRolePattern: PySide6.QtCore.QRegularExpression#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.rotationRoleReplace: str#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.rowCategories: list of strings#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.rowRole: str#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.rowRolePattern: PySide6.QtCore.QRegularExpression#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.rowRoleReplace: str#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.useModelCategories: bool#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.valueRole: str#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.valueRolePattern: PySide6.QtCore.QRegularExpression#
Access functions:
property PᅟySide6.QtGraphs.QItemModelBarDataProxy.valueRoleReplace: str#
Access functions:
PySide6.QtGraphs.QItemModelBarDataProxy.MultiMatchBehavior#
PySide6.QtGraphs.QItemModelBarDataProxy.autoColumnCategories()#
Return type:

bool

Getter of property autoColumnC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.autoColumnCategoriesChanged(enable)#
Parameters:

enable – bool

Notification signal of property autoColumnC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.autoRowCategories()#
Return type:

bool

Getter of property autoRowC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.autoRowCategoriesChanged(enable)#
Parameters:

enable – bool

Notification signal of property autoRowC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.columnCategories()#
Return type:

list of strings

Getter of property columnC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.columnCategoriesChanged()#

Notification signal of property columnC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.columnCategoryIndex(category)#
Parameters:

category – str

Return type:

int

PySide6.QtGraphs.QItemModelBarDataProxy.columnRole()#
Return type:

str

Getter of property columnRole .

PySide6.QtGraphs.QItemModelBarDataProxy.columnRoleChanged(role)#
Parameters:

role – str

Notification signal of property columnRole .

PySide6.QtGraphs.QItemModelBarDataProxy.columnRolePattern()#
Return type:

PySide6.QtCore.QRegularExpression

Getter of property columnR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.columnRolePatternChanged(pattern)#
Parameters:

patternPySide6.QtCore.QRegularExpression

Notification signal of property columnR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.columnRoleReplace()#
Return type:

str

Getter of property columnR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.columnRoleReplaceChanged(replace)#
Parameters:

replace – str

Notification signal of property columnR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.itemModel()#
Return type:

PySide6.QtCore.QAbstractItemModel

Getter of property itemModel .

PySide6.QtGraphs.QItemModelBarDataProxy.itemModelChanged(itemModel)#
Parameters:

itemModelPySide6.QtCore.QAbstractItemModel

Notification signal of property itemModel .

PySide6.QtGraphs.QItemModelBarDataProxy.multiMatchBehavior()#
Return type:

MultiMatchBehavior

Getter of property multiMatchBehavior .

PySide6.QtGraphs.QItemModelBarDataProxy.multiMatchBehaviorChanged(behavior)#
Parameters:

behaviorMultiMatchBehavior

Notification signal of property multiMatchBehavior .

PySide6.QtGraphs.QItemModelBarDataProxy.remap(rowRole, columnRole, valueRole, rotationRole, rowCategories, columnCategories)#
Parameters:
  • rowRole – str

  • columnRole – str

  • valueRole – str

  • rotationRole – str

  • rowCategories – list of strings

  • columnCategories – list of strings

PySide6.QtGraphs.QItemModelBarDataProxy.rotationRole()#
Return type:

str

Getter of property rotationRole .

PySide6.QtGraphs.QItemModelBarDataProxy.rotationRoleChanged(role)#
Parameters:

role – str

Notification signal of property rotationRole .

PySide6.QtGraphs.QItemModelBarDataProxy.rotationRolePattern()#
Return type:

PySide6.QtCore.QRegularExpression

Getter of property rotationR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.rotationRolePatternChanged(pattern)#
Parameters:

patternPySide6.QtCore.QRegularExpression

Notification signal of property rotationR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.rotationRoleReplace()#
Return type:

str

Getter of property rotationR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.rotationRoleReplaceChanged(replace)#
Parameters:

replace – str

Notification signal of property rotationR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.rowCategories()#
Return type:

list of strings

Getter of property rowC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.rowCategoriesChanged()#

Notification signal of property rowC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.rowCategoryIndex(category)#
Parameters:

category – str

Return type:

int

PySide6.QtGraphs.QItemModelBarDataProxy.rowRole()#
Return type:

str

Getter of property rowRole .

PySide6.QtGraphs.QItemModelBarDataProxy.rowRoleChanged(role)#
Parameters:

role – str

Notification signal of property rowRole .

PySide6.QtGraphs.QItemModelBarDataProxy.rowRolePattern()#
Return type:

PySide6.QtCore.QRegularExpression

Getter of property rowR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.rowRolePatternChanged(pattern)#
Parameters:

patternPySide6.QtCore.QRegularExpression

Notification signal of property rowR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.rowRoleReplace()#
Return type:

str

Getter of property rowR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.rowRoleReplaceChanged(replace)#
Parameters:

replace – str

Notification signal of property rowR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.setAutoColumnCategories(enable)#
Parameters:

enable – bool

Setter of property autoColumnC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.setAutoRowCategories(enable)#
Parameters:

enable – bool

Setter of property autoRowC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.setColumnCategories(categories)#
Parameters:

categories – list of strings

Setter of property columnC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.setColumnRole(role)#
Parameters:

role – str

Setter of property columnRole .

PySide6.QtGraphs.QItemModelBarDataProxy.setColumnRolePattern(pattern)#
Parameters:

patternPySide6.QtCore.QRegularExpression

Setter of property columnR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.setColumnRoleReplace(replace)#
Parameters:

replace – str

Setter of property columnR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.setItemModel(itemModel)#
Parameters:

itemModelPySide6.QtCore.QAbstractItemModel

Setter of property itemModel .

PySide6.QtGraphs.QItemModelBarDataProxy.setMultiMatchBehavior(behavior)#
Parameters:

behaviorMultiMatchBehavior

Setter of property multiMatchBehavior .

PySide6.QtGraphs.QItemModelBarDataProxy.setRotationRole(role)#
Parameters:

role – str

Setter of property rotationRole .

PySide6.QtGraphs.QItemModelBarDataProxy.setRotationRolePattern(pattern)#
Parameters:

patternPySide6.QtCore.QRegularExpression

Setter of property rotationR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.setRotationRoleReplace(replace)#
Parameters:

replace – str

Setter of property rotationR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.setRowCategories(categories)#
Parameters:

categories – list of strings

Setter of property rowC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.setRowRole(role)#
Parameters:

role – str

Setter of property rowRole .

PySide6.QtGraphs.QItemModelBarDataProxy.setRowRolePattern(pattern)#
Parameters:

patternPySide6.QtCore.QRegularExpression

Setter of property rowR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.setRowRoleReplace(replace)#
Parameters:

replace – str

Setter of property rowR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.setUseModelCategories(enable)#
Parameters:

enable – bool

Setter of property useModelC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.setValueRole(role)#
Parameters:

role – str

Setter of property valueRole .

PySide6.QtGraphs.QItemModelBarDataProxy.setValueRolePattern(pattern)#
Parameters:

patternPySide6.QtCore.QRegularExpression

Setter of property valueR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.setValueRoleReplace(replace)#
Parameters:

replace – str

Setter of property valueR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.useModelCategories()#
Return type:

bool

Getter of property useModelC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.useModelCategoriesChanged(enable)#
Parameters:

enable – bool

Notification signal of property useModelCategories .

PySide6.QtGraphs.QItemModelBarDataProxy.valueRole()#
Return type:

str

Getter of property valueRole .

PySide6.QtGraphs.QItemModelBarDataProxy.valueRoleChanged(role)#
Parameters:

role – str

Notification signal of property valueRole .

PySide6.QtGraphs.QItemModelBarDataProxy.valueRolePattern()#
Return type:

PySide6.QtCore.QRegularExpression

Getter of property valueR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.valueRolePatternChanged(pattern)#
Parameters:

patternPySide6.QtCore.QRegularExpression

Notification signal of property valueRolePattern .

PySide6.QtGraphs.QItemModelBarDataProxy.valueRoleReplace()#
Return type:

str

Getter of property valueRoleReplace .

PySide6.QtGraphs.QItemModelBarDataProxy.valueRoleReplaceChanged(replace)#
Parameters:

replace – str

Notification signal of property valueRoleReplace .